Interior style and design: Five ideas for generating a house glance a lot more high-priced

Preston Konrad is a life style expert and previous director of styling at luxurious retailer Ralph Lauren. He took to TikTok to share his five best interior design guidelines for producing a home sense additional high-priced on a spending plan.

“In this article are 5 points you can do appropriate now to make your house glimpse much more pricey.”

Preston’s very first suggestion was to layer your rugs.

“When I labored for Ralph Lauren that was form of a prerequisite, we had to do this in all the retailers that we intended.”

But why is it this sort of a critical inside design and style move?

The design pro “It provides texture, dimension, and would make your residence just appear a little bit much more curated.”

But he extra a caveat: “I do not like it when they are tremendous symmetrical.”

He prefers them a tiny uneven or at an angle.

Preston’s subsequent idea was to get rid of ‘boob lights’ – flush mount dome mild fixtures.

He proposed the interior style blog Nadine Continue to be, which offers tips of what property owners can swap their lights with.

But renters, do not despair, as Konrad believes that you should not have to set up with these certain formed lights possibly.

“If you’re a renter, take down the boob, put up your gentle and replace it just before you depart.”

Suggestion range three for creating a home search extra expensive was to devote in some roman shades, which the expert stated can be very “economical”.

He explained: “It is really perfect for a area with a shorter ceiling or a window that isn’t tremendous extraordinary.”

Preston’s fourth idea was to experiment with texture and never be frightened to combine it up.

Calling it a “designer favourite’, he recommended inside design lovers to utilise wooden, leather, concrete and classic materials.

“Past but not the very least, blend up your frames.

“These absolutely must not match if you want that curated designer seem.”

Likely back again to his issue about textures and resources, Preston suggested playing with both equally picket and black gallery frames.

“And I even like throwing an item into the combine to make it come to feel definitely special.”
